I also wanted to share a few tips/advise for others who will build this:

-If you choose to do a main color, make sure you have enough of it! I used acrylic markers and I used the most of red. I had to buy two additional packs of markers because the red ran out way before I was finished AND they weren’t even the same shade! I don’t know if you can tell from the photos, but the red in the back of the model is a different shade from that of the other red like the sides and rails on ramps.

-When you are on the step where you are putting in the plastic circle pieces on the playing board, they MUST go in a certain way because when you put on the wood piece behind them a few steps later, there are grooves they must fit in. I didn’t know this and I couldn’t get them back out so I ended up breaking the tabs off the best I could and sanding them down so that they were flush with the piece put over them. (Sorry it might be hard to understand as I don’t know the piece numbers!)

-On page 37, build F17, F18, and J7 and insert into hole with wire. Then add C13 and C25 pieces to make it easier to see where J7 goes. Also, the wire will protrude out some behind F8.

+This is a positive and I didn’t get a picture of it, but the wires underneath are very clearly labeled and look very clean and organized under there!
